Sealing

Window seals (also known as uPVC seals) play an important role in the insulation and double-glazed windows. Incorrect seals can cause drafts, condensation and other issues. Seals that are damaged can be repaired or even replaced to improve the efficiency of your double-glazing.

The leakage of water between glass panes is the most common sign of double-glazed windows that require to be sealed. This moisture could damage the window frames and raise energy bills. Moisture in between glass frames can cause a foggy look that can come and go depending upon indoor/outdoor temperature or humidity levels.

If you suspect that the seals on your double-glazed windows aren't working, it's best to call the installer. They will visit your home and reseal damaged areas, which is often cheaper than replacing the entire window unit. Review your warranty documentation to determine if the company that installed your double-glazed windows may be under warranty. This will save you money in the long run on repairs or replacements.

A double-glazed window repair technician will use various tools to fix your windows that are damaged, including gasket rollers that help to push the new seals into the proper position. These tools help to create an airtight seal that is essential to the operation of your windows.

If the seal between double-glazed window's glass panes becomes defective, it could result in a variety of issues, including condensation between the panes, a lack of energy efficiency and a misaligned view. The replacement of the window seal typically involves removal of the glass and replacing it with a new one which can be done in the majority of cases without having to replace the entire frame of the window.

You should hire an expert to replace or repair double-glazed window seals. It's usually more time-consuming and laborious than doing it yourself. Additionally, it's best to get a double-glazing repair company that is registered and certified since this will give you confidence that they will do the job properly.

Glass

Double-glazed windows are composed of two panes, with an air space between them. The air is filled with gases like argon and krypton that slow the transfer of heat through your windows. This lets you maintain a the temperature of your home without overworking your heating and cooling systems. If one of your double-glazed windows becomes broken or cracked, you'll want to repair it as quickly as possible.

Hardware

Double glazed windows can develop various issues over time. These include problems with the seals, water ingress and foggy glass. Many people believe that they must replace their entire window whenever these issues occur, the good news is that the majority of them can be repaired without the need for an entirely new installation.

To repair a double glazed window the first step is to remove the existing pane from the frame. This should be done with care to avoid further damage to the glass. The next step is to remove any sealants or paint around the edges of your glass. This can be done with the help of a putty knife or scraper. Once the old pane is removed, the new one can be inserted into the frame. A fresh layer of sealant should then be applied.

If the window is covered by warranty, you may be able to have the manufacturer replace the glass unit at no cost. If not, employ a professional to examine and repair the window.

While the glass is an important element of a double glazed window, the hardware is also vital to ensure that it works effectively. The sash and the balance are used to open and close the window. These parts can cause problems with the window and can even pose a safety risk. If the balance or sash are damaged, it is recommended to consult an expert in double glazing to repair the damage.

Condensation in between the panes is a common issue with double-glazed windows. This is caused by warm air coming in contact with the cooler window panes. Although this is a natural process, it can lead to water infiltration and decay. Installing a ventilator in your house is the best method to prevent this.

It is crucial to locate a double-glazing firm who has experience working with historic buildings if you own a listed building. In many cases it is possible for listed buildings to be equipped with slim profile double-glazed units without compromising their character. These windows can be made to look similar to the original windows, and will keep your house warm without compromising its historic charm.
